    Understanding Wood Glue Clamping Time

    To ensure the success of your woodworking project, it’s crucial to understand the optimal clamping time for wood glue. The waiting period before unclamping plays a significant role in the strength and integrity of your final creation.

    Factors Influencing Clamping Time

    1. Type of Wood: Different wood types absorb glue differently, affecting the drying time. Hardwoods like oak may require longer clamping times compared to softwoods such as pine.
    2. Humidity and Temperature: High humidity and cold temperatures can prolong the drying process, necessitating extended clamping times for the glue to set properly.
    3. Type of Glue: Various wood glues have different drying times. For instance, traditional yellow wood glue typically requires 30 minutes to 1 hour of clamping, while epoxy resin may need several hours.

    Optimal Clamping Durations for Common Wood Glues

    1. Yellow Wood Glue: It’s advisable to keep pieces clamped for at least 30 minutes to an hour for optimal bonding before removing the clamps.
    2. Cyanoacrylate (CA) Glue: CA glue sets quickly, usually within 5-15 minutes, but allowing it to cure for a full 24 hours under clamping pressure ensures the strongest bond.
    3. Polyurethane Glue: Polyurethane glue may require up to 2 hours of clamping time, depending on the humidity and temperature conditions.

    Testing the Bond

    After the recommended clamping time has elapsed, conduct a thorough check to ensure the glue has fully cured. Gently tap the wood joints or conduct stress tests to confirm the strength of the bond before proceeding with further steps in your project.

    Tips for Ensuring Proper Clamping

    When working with wood glue in your DIY projects, ensuring proper clamping is crucial for strong, durable bonds. Here are some practical tips to help you achieve optimal clamping results:

    1. Prepare Your Workspace:

    Clear your work area and have all necessary tools and materials ready before starting. This will help you work efficiently and prevent any delays during the clamping process.

    2. Apply the Right Amount of Glue:

    Make sure to apply an even layer of glue on the surfaces to be joined. Using too little glue can result in weak bonds, while excess glue can create a messy finish.

    3. Choose the Correct Clamping Pressure:

    Adjust the clamping pressure based on the type of wood and glue being used. For softwoods, moderate pressure is usually sufficient, while hardwoods may require tighter clamping for optimal adhesion.

    4. Monitor Temperature and Humidity:

    Consider the temperature and humidity levels in your workspace, as these factors can affect the curing time of the glue. In colder or more humid conditions, you may need to extend the clamping time to ensure a strong bond.

    5. Follow Manufacturer’s Guidelines:

    Always refer to the manufacturer’s instructions for the specific type of wood glue you are using. Different glues have varying curing times, so following the recommended guidelines will help you achieve the best results.

    6. Conduct a Test Clamping:

    Before applying glue to your main project, conduct a test clamping on scrap wood to determine the ideal clamping time. This will allow you to make any necessary adjustments before working on your final piece.

    7. Use Caution with Porous Woods:

    Porous woods, such as oak or pine, may require longer clamping times to ensure proper bonding. Be mindful of the wood type you are working with and adjust the clamping duration accordingly.
